Abstract

Objective : This study explores whether and how the amount of smoking differs by economic status and perception among the men in working age. Methods : The study utilized the 4th wave of KoWEPS containing the items on perception of economic conditions. Analysis was conducted on ever-married men aged 30-54, who have capacity to work. It used 2 stage regression model methods to examine the mediation effect of perception on economic status. Results : The results shows that the negative perception on economic status has a positive effect on smoking. Disposable income affects smoking only through the perception of economic status. Employment status exerts both direct and indirect effect on smoking. Conclusions : These findings imply that less privileged economic status is related to smoking through anxiety or stress for the negative perception on it.

연구목적: 본 연구에서는 경제활동이 활발할 것으로 기대되는 성인 남성군의 흡연량이 객관적인 경제 상황 외에 주관적 경제 인식에 따라 달라지는지를 확인하였다. 연구방법: 통계분석에는 경제적 상황에 대한 전망 변수가 조사된 제 4차 한국복지패널조사(KoWEPS) 자료를 사용하였으며, 근로능력을 갖추고, 결혼 이력이 있는 30세-54세 기혼 남성에 대해 매개효과 확인을 위한 3단계 회귀분석을 실시하였다. 연구결과: 경제적 상황은 경제적 인식에 직접적인 영향을 주는 것으로 나타났다(1단계). 경제적 전망에 대한 부정적 인식은 흡연량과 정적인 관계에 있었고(2단계), 가구의 가처분소득은 다만 경제적 전망을 통해서만 흡연량에 영향을 주는 것으로 나타났다(3단계). 이를 통해 경제적 상황은 청 장년층 흡연량에 대해 경제적 인식을 통한 매개 효과를 가지는 것을 확인할 수 있다. 결론: 구매력이 충분한 청 장년층 남성 인구집단에서 열등한 경제적 지위는 이와 관련된 부정적 인식과, 우려 그리고 스트레스 등을 통해서 흡연에 영향을 준다. 따라서 이들 집단에 대해서는 가격적 정책의 효과가 상대적으로 낮게 나타날 가능성을 시사하며 비가격적 정책이 함께 실시되어야 할 필요성을 보여준다.
